Biography
2014.6 | Graduated from Southwest University, China |
---|---|
2016.9 | Master's degree in Chemistry, Graduate School of Science, Tohoku University, Japan |
2019.9 | Ph.D. in Chemistry, Graduate School of Science, Tohoku University, Japan |
2019.9 | Obtained Ph.D. in Science from Tohoku University, Japan |
2019.10 – 2020.3 | Postdoctoral Researcher at the Institute for Materials Research (AIMR), Tohoku University, Japan |
2020.4 – 2022.8 | Advanced Production Technology Development, Toshiba Corporation, Battery Business Unit |
2022.9 – Present | Designated Assistant Professor, Department of Applied Chemistry, Graduate School of Engineering, Nagoya University, Japan |
